Origin and Cultural Significance

Fruit-filled dessert bars became popular throughout the United States as home bakers searched for easier alternatives to traditional pies. By using a simple batter or crust spread into a baking pan, bakers could create desserts that served large groups while maintaining the beloved flavors of classic fruit pies.

Cherry desserts have long held a special place in American baking, particularly in regions known for cherry production. Cherry Pie Bars continue this tradition by offering the sweet-tart flavor of cherries in a convenient, shareable format that is ideal for community gatherings and family events.

Ingredients

For the Bars

  • 1 cup (226g) unsalted butter, softened
  • 2 cups (400g) granulated sugar
  • 4 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 3 cups (375g) all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 can (21 oz) cherry pie filling

For the Glaze

  • 1 cup (120g) powdered sugar
  • 2 tablespoons milk
  • ½ teaspoon vanilla extract

Servings

Makes 20–24 bars.

Tips for Success

  • Use room-temperature butter for easier mixing.
  • Do not overmix the batter after adding the flour.
  • Spread the cherry filling evenly for consistent flavor.
  • Allow the bars to cool completely before glazing.
  • Refrigerate briefly before slicing for cleaner cuts.
  • Store covered to maintain freshness.

Instructions

Step 1: Prepare the Oven

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).

Grease a 10×15-inch jelly roll pan or baking sheet with sides.

Step 2: Make the Batter

In a large mixing bowl, beat together:

  • Butter
  • Sugar

until light and fluffy.

Add e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ition.

Stir in vanilla extract.

Step 3: Add Dry Ingredients

Gradually mix in:

  • Flour
  • Salt

until a smooth batter forms.

Step 4: Assemble

Spread about two-thirds of the batter evenly into the prepared pan.

Carefully spread the cherry pie filling over the batter.

Drop spoonfuls of the remaining batter over the cherry filling.

Step 5: Bake

Bake for 35–40 minutes, or until lightly golden and set.

Step 6: Cool

Allow the bars to cool completely in the pan.

Step 7: Make the Glaze

Whisk together:

  • Powdered sugar
  • Milk
  • Vanilla extract

until smooth.

Step 8: Finish

Drizzle the glaze over the cooled bars.

Allow the glaze to set before slicing.
